Hi Niels,

I 'm trying to compile waves2foam on OF2.4.0 but i encounter some errors with respect to libraries i suppose. I followed the process according to wiki (downloading GSL first -its directory is in usr/include-etc). I attach the wmake file. Have you any idea what's going wrong because i encounter the same problem even i try to compile it on OF2.2.2 on another desktop.

Good evening,

@Nick: Note that you also need to have gfortran available. The errors relate to a missing gfortran library.
